Professional Profile
Dr. Ming Xie is an assistant professor of public administration and emergency management administration. She received her Ph.D. in Public Administration from University of Nebraska at Omaha. She also received a Ph.D. in Cultural Anthropology from Chinese Academy of Social Sciences, Beijing, China.
Teaching and Related Service
Dr. Xie teaches courses in the areas of Emergency Management and nonprofit Management, including Introduction to Emergency Management and Social Vulnerability, Municipal Government, and Directed Research in Emergency Management.
Research and Creative Activity
Dr. Xie's research focuses on emergency management and social vulnerability, nonprofit accountability,and intercultural communication.
Dr. Xie is a member of the Association for Research on Nonprofit Organization and Voluntary Action
Dr. Xie is a member of the International Society of the Third Sector Research
Dr. Xie is a member of the International Communication Association and National Communication Association
Dr. Xie has published peer-reviewed journal articles and book chapters in the field of public administration, emergency management, and intercultural communication.
She always seeks opportunities of community engagement through her research projects, to enhance the community's capacity in emergency prepardeness and community resilience.
